Welding rod structure
The internal metal built-in metal core and an outer coating of the electrode. The core is a steel wire having a certain diameter and length. The main function of the core is that the conductive current makes it heated, and the connecting workpiece is filled.
Welded cores can generally be divided into carbon steel, alloy steel and stainless steel. However, in order to meet the welding requirements, there is a special requirement for the material of the core and the metal element, and the content of some metal elements is strictly regulated. Because the metal composition of the core material directly affects the quality of the weld.
There is a coating outside the electrode, which is called a pharmaceutical skin. Percutaneous effects play an important role. If the welding core is directly welded to the workpiece, the air and the like will enter the molten metal of the dielectric core, and the chemical reaction occurs in the molten metal, which directly causes the weld. Quality problems such as pores, cracks directly affect the welding strength. Coatings containing special elements decompose melt into gas and slag at high temperatures, which can effectively prevent air from entering, improve welding quality.
The ingredients of the pharmaceutical skin include: hydrochloric acid, fluoride, carbonate, oxide, organic matter, ferric alloy and other chemical powders, etc., which are mixed according to a certain formulation ratio. The coating composition of different types of electrode coatings is also different.
The coating of the core surface generally has two thicknesses, and the main components of the coating are substantially the same.
There are three types, namely, slag, gas generating agents, and deoxidizers.
The slag is a compound which protects the molten metal liquid when the electrode is melted, thereby increasing the quality of the welding.
Gas generants are mainly composed of substances such as starch and wood powder, have a certain reduction.
The deoxidizer consists of titanium iron and manganese. Typically, such substances can increase the wear resistance and corrosion resistance of metals.
In addition, there are other types of coatings on the surface of the electrodes, each type of ingredients and proportions will vary.
Welding rod manufacturing process
The manufacturing process of the welding rod is based on the design of the welding rod to make the die and prepare the coating, and the coating is uniformly applied to the welding core, which conforms to the design requirements of the qualified electrode.
First, the rolled steel bars are pulled out from the coiled machine, and the rust of the surface of the steel bar is removed in the machine, and then straightened, and the steel bar is cut into the length of the electrode.
Next, it is necessary to prepare the coating on the surface of the electrode. The various raw materials of the coating were screened to remove the impurities, and then inserted into the machine, and the binder was added. All powdered raw materials are thicker through the stirring of the machine.
The mixed powder is placed in the mold, and the cylindrical cylinder having a circular hole in the middle is pressed.
Put the pressed plurality of bottles into the machine, and place the core into the machine feed port, the solder core into the machine from the machine feed port, the solder core passes through the center of the cartridge due to extrusion. machine. The powder is uniformly applied to the passing core to become a coating.
During the coating process of the electrode, the entire solder core is applied to a layer of coating. In order to make the electrode easy to clamp and conduct electricity, the head and tail of the electrode need to be polished, and the solder core is exposed.
After coating the coating, the grinding head and the grinding electrode will be uniformly arranged on the iron frame, and the oven is dried.
In order to be able to distinguish the specifications of the electrode, it is necessary to print on the electrode. When the electrode moves on the conveyor belt, each electrode is printed by a rubber printing roller on the conveyor belt.
The welding rod print is completed, and the solder rod is checked and sold.
